Mac mini g4 via Ethernet to older modified squeezebox sb3. Is this older Mac mini a reasonable source? I would need to add an external storage (does it have fire wire?). I have a chance at this Mac mini for low $$. The Mac mini will not be used for any other functions

It has Firewire 400. You'll want to check that it has Leopard (OSX 10.5) on it, as the current version of itunes needs it. Can't comment on the SB.

The SB3 will require Squeezebox Server which ports to pretty much any OS. I'm not aware of any Squeeze Box capable of play back from any other SW. The good news is that its free.

I used a G4 for quite a while with no problems using a setup as you described. One limitation you will have is that some of the newer players such as Audirvana require Mac OS 10.6 and some software runs only on Intel processors. I mention this in case you decide to try another player. I haven't looked around but I would imagine there are plenty of used Intel Mac Minis on Ebay.
